Top 5 Food and Drink Apps on Android in Croatia: Q3 2023
Discover the performance trends of the top Food and Drink apps on Android in Croatia during Q3 2023, including we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
The third quarter of 2023 presented some interesting trends for the top Food and Drink apps on Android in Croatia. Data from Sensor Tower offers insights into the weekly downloads, revenue, and active users for these apps.
Pam App from Pamela Rf exhibited a steady weekly revenue, peaking at around $72 in the week of July 24. Weekly downloads saw a significant increase, reaching 47 in mid-August, but fluctuated throughout the quarter. The app's active users started at 578 in late June and gradually decreased to 443 by the end of September.
クックパッド -みんなが作ってる料理レシピで、ご飯をおいしく by Cookpad Inc. maintained a consistent weekly revenue, hovering around $40 to $43 throughout Q3. Weekly downloads showed some variability, peaking at 41 in the last week of June, but dropping to 13 by the end of July. Active users showed a positive trend, increasing from 386 in late June to 416 in late August, before settling at 378 by the end of September.
クラシル - 毎日の献立に!レシピ動画で料理がおいしく作れる from dely, Inc. recorded a stable weekly revenue, fluctuating around $21 to $26. The app's weekly downloads were highest at the end of June with 53, but saw a dip to 21 by the end of July. Active users peaked at 759 in mid-September, showing a general upward trend from the start of the quarter.
Brewfather from Warpkode AS saw a varied revenue trend, hitting a high of $41 in the week of August 28. Downloads were minimal, with only a couple of weeks registering any activity.
Cookpad: Find & Share Recipes by Cookpad Inc. (UK) experienced a steady revenue trend, averaging around $12 to $16 per week. Weekly downloads fluctuated significantly, starting at 276 in late June and hovering around 100 to 200 for most of the quarter. Active users saw a peak of 698 in early July, but then experienced a decline, stabilizing around the mid-500s by the end of September.
